IBM Support

PI34203: EXCEPTIONS IN WAS WHEN GETTING IBM.WORKLIGHT.ADMIN PROPERTIES

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• Exceptions such as:
    
    javax.naming.ConfigurationException: A JNDI operation on a
    "java:" name cannot be completed because the server runtime is
    not able to associate the operation's thread with any J2EE
    application component.  This condition can occur when the JNDI
    client using the "java:" name is not executed on the thread of a
    server application request.  Make sure that a J2EE application
    does not execute JNDI operations on "java:" names within static
    code blocks or in threads created by that J2EE application.
    Such code does not necessarily run on the thread of a server
    application request and therefore is not supported by JNDI
    operations on "java:" names. [Root exception is
    javax.naming.NameNotFoundException: Name
    "comp/env/ibm.worklight.admin.actions.commitRejectTimeout" not
    found in context "java:".]
    
    may appear in the server logs when running on the WebSphere
    Application Server and trying to retrieve the properties
    ibm.worklight.admin.actions.commitRejectTimeout,
    ibm.worklight.admin.actions.prepareTimeout or
    ibm.worklight.admin.lockTimeoutInMillis.
    

Local fix

  • These messages may be safely ignored unless you try to set one
    of the JNDI property names.
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ED:                                              *
    * All users of the Worklight console in a WebSphere            *
    * Application Server environment                               *
    ****************************************************************
    * PROBLEM DESCRIPTION:                                         *
    * Exceptions are emitted in the WebSphere Application Server   *
    * ffdc files concerning JNDI lookup like :                     *
    *                                                              *
    * javax.naming.ConfigurationException: A JNDI operation on a   *
    * "java:" name cannot be completed because the server runtime  *
    * is not able to associate the operation's thread with any     *
    * J2EE application component.  This condition can occur when   *
    * the JNDI client using the "java:" name is not executed on    *
    * the thread of a server application request.  Make sure that  *
    * a J2EE application does not execute JNDI operations on       *
    * "java:" names within static code blocks or in threads        *
    * created by that J2EE application.  Such code does not        *
    * necessarily run on the thread of a server application        *
    * request and therefore is not supported by JNDI operations on *
    * "java:" names. [Root exception is                            *
    * javax.naming.NameNotFoundException: Name                     *
    * "comp/env/ibm.worklight.admin.actions.commitRejectTimeout"   *
    * not found in context "java:".]                               *
    *                                                              *
    * This concerns the following JNDI Properties:                 *
    * ibm.worklight.admin.actions.prepareTimeout,                  *
    * ibm.worklight.admin.actions.commitRejectTimeout and          *
    * ibm.worklight.admin.lockTimeoutInMillis                      *
    ****************************************************************
    * RECOMMENDATION:                                              *
    * -                                                            *
    ****************************************************************
    

Problem conclusion

  • No more exceptions are emitted for these JNDI properties.
    

Temporary fix

Comments

APAR Information

  • APAR number

    PI34203

  • Reported component name

    WL/MFPF ENTERPR

  • Reported component ID

    5725I4300

  • Reported release

    620

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2015-02-04

  • Closed date

    2015-02-17

  • Last modified date

    2015-02-17

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    WL/MFPF ENTERPR

  • Fixed component ID

    5725I4300

Applicable component levels

  • R620 PSY

       UP

  • R630 PSY

       UP

[{"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Product":{"code":"SSZH4A","label":"IBM Worklight"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"620","Line of Business":{"code":"LOB45","label":"Automation"}}]

Document Information

Modified date:
15 October 2021